Provincial

usgb/prəˈvɪnʃl/
adjective

Relating to a certain area or region's local level or services, not national.

They advanced their notions at the provincial level.

LampPro Tip 1/3

Geographical Context

Use 'provincial' to describe things related to parts of a country outside the capital or major cities.

She enjoyed the provincial charm of the small towns.
LampPro Tip 2/3

Not Global

'Provincial' implies a connection to a specific region within a country rather than international or worldwide scope.

The festival featured provincial cuisines from around the country.
LampPro Tip 3/3

Governmental Use

When discussing government or administration, 'provincial' refers to the regional, not federal level.

The provincial laws were more relaxed than those at the national level.
